I use a "Billy Goat" brand of leaf vac that is highly regarded by those in the leaf and debris pickup field. I have a small one that you push like a lawnmower, but they make several larger systems including one that loads directly into a pickup bed. I have occasionally seen the latter model for sale on the internet classifieds. Billy Goat does have a website: www.billygoat.com

Lou, I have a JD mower and their MC519 tow behind bagger. Not cheap, but I am happy with it. Have lots of leaves to pick up...LOTS of leaves. I vac 'em at least once a week for about two months. Supposed to hold 19 bushel.
